NVIDIA is hiring a Solution Architect for the AI Technology Centre team in Bavaria, Germany. This role is ideal for scientists who can also clearly define and apply strong strategic capabilities. Applicants must have significant publication records, community recognition, and research credibility to partner with Europe’s outstanding research groups on equal terms.

What you'll be doing:

  • Participate in high impact research projects alongside university PIs and their research labs;
  • Identify and evaluate new high-value research opportunities in Generative AI, Agentic AI and Physical AI;
  • Champion the adoption of NVIDIA software platforms and models (such as NeMo, NIMs, Cosmos, Warp, Newton, CUDA-X, NemoClaw, Nemotron AI models) to tackle groundbreaking scientific challenges;
  • Shape and nurture strategic institutional agreements with top Bavarian universities and research institutions;
  • Empower academic partners by helping them secure critical research funding from external sources;
  • Act as a bridge between academic partners and NVIDIA product, program, and engineering teams. Communicate software and hardware requirements to ensure our solutions continue to drive world-class research;
  • Deliver strategic insights on emerging trends, breakthroughs from the research ecosystem or labs;
  • Coordinate and deliver outreach activities (e.g., NVIDIA AI Days, NVIDIA Agentic AI Events);
  • Help university PIs mentor postgraduate students.

What we need to see:

  • Ph.D. in Computer Science, Applied Mathematics, Physics, Engineering, Robotics;
  • Research publications in Generative AI, Agentic AI or Physical AI;
  • Experience working in academic research groups;
  • Comprehensive knowledge of Generative AI, Agentic AI and Physical AI: perception, sim-to-real transfer, world models, LLMs, VLMs, agentic AI systems;
  • Experience with scientific policy engagement, grant processes, or national/European research program structures;
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ills in English;
  • Proven ability to work collaboratively in a team environment and learn new technologies quickly;
  • 5+ years of hands-on experience in Generative AI research.

Ways to stand out from the crowd:

  • Postdoctoral or faculty experience is a plus, but no more than 10 years following a Ph.D;
  • Recognition across the research community with awards, named fellowships and grants in Generative AI, Agentic AI and Physical AI domains;
  • Experience in technology transfer - advancing research prototypes toward product integration or extensive platform deployment;
  • Experience building and implementing projects with NVIDIA software platforms.
